Re: P.A. Dunkin's letter and imminent demise of net.wobegon

I second this letter's statements, and have but one thing to add:
I for one have sat back and just READ the news from net.wobegon for weeks at
a time before actually contributing anything, and I suspect this pattern may
not be unusual; the type of people who would elect to read such a newsgroup in
the first place are probably not going to be voluminous posters.

And as Mr. Dunkin pointed out, we certainly have one of the most well-mannered
groups on the net.

I suspect just knowing that net.wobegon exists brings a smile and a ray of
sunshine into the lives of many a not-necessarily-Norwegian bachelor hacker.
Please reconsider your decision.
